In late March 2002, the world of men's tennis was in a state of flux. Older champions, vestiges of 1990's still trotted around the circut and mingled with the teenie boppers. Questions had been raised, who was the world's best tennis player? Was the number one ranked player the same person as the world's best player?

The 2002 Aussie Open did little to calm the storm. Andre Agassi, a 30 plus living legend prepared diligently for the year's opening Major. A two time defending champion, and three times winner overall, Agassi was arguably at the top of his game. Judging by the fact that over the past fews Australian Open's he'd vanquished just about every top contender set before him. Sampras, Rafter, Kafelnikov, Martin, Philippoussis all fell victim. 

On the rebound ace, he was indeed the gold standard. But as fate ordained, the decided front runner was derailed even before he could crush a single service return. A freak wrist injury sustained in an exhibition sealed his fate. Agassi was forced to withdraw. Having battled wrist injuries before, Agassi knew the arduous road ahead and quietly wondered about the fate of his career. He was already an old man by tennis standards.

The meteoric rise of Lleyton Hewitt landed him in the top for 2001. His shocking dismantling of the King of Swing, Pete Sampras in the U.S. Open final sparked an interesting debate. Were the youngsters, names like Hewitt, Safin, Fererro, Roddick, and even some kid named Federer ready to take up the banner for the sport? Even more questions surrounded the two pillars of the sport, Sampras and Agassi.

By now Sampras was certainly on the down side of his career. Little did we know then that 2002 would be his final season on tour. Following the straight set thrashing he suffered in Flushing Meadows, Sampras was undone once again.
